Marijuana is grown from one of 2 s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ring genetic details from two parent plants and can express various mixes of qualities: some from the mother, some from the daddy, and some traits from both. In business cannabis production, usually, growers will plant lots of seeds of one stress and select the finest plant. They will then take clones from that individual plant, which enables consistent genetics for mass production. autoflowering cannabis seeds. Growing from seed can produce a more powerful plant with more solid genetics.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, mainly since se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ds straight into an outside garden in early spring, even in cool, damp climates. If growing outdoors, some growers choose to sprout seeds inside since they are fragile in the starting phases of development. Inside your home, you can provide weed seedlings supplemental light to assist them along, and after that transplant them outside when big enough. You'll require to sex them out (more listed below) to recognize the males and get rid of them, due to the fact that you don't want your women producing seeds - feminized marijuana seeds. Sexing cannabis plants can be a time-consuming procedure, and if you don't capture males, there is a risk that even one males can pollinate your whole crop, causing all of your female weed plants to produce seeds. One way to prevent sexing plants is to buy feminized seeds (more listed below), which ensures every seed you plant will be a bud-producing woman. You can also lessen headaches and avoid the hassle of seed germination and sexing plants by beginning with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ically identical to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is called the "mom." Through cloning, you can create a brand-new harvest with precise reproductions of your preferred plant. Due to the fact that genes are similar, a clone will give you a plant with the very same characteristics as the mom, such as flavor,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, etc. So if you stumble upon a specific stress or phenotype you actually like, you might wish to clone it to reproduce more buds that have the exact same impacts and characteristics. With cloning, you don't need to get brand-new seeds whenever you desire to grow another plantyou just take a cutting of the old plantand you don't need to germinate seeds or sex them out and get rid of the males. autoflowering seeds.
Another disadvantage to clones is they can handle unfavorable characteristics from the mother plant too. If the mom has a disease, brings in pests, or grows weak branches, its clones will probably have the same concerns. Feminized cannabis seeds will produce just female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to remove males or stress over female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by triggering the monoecious condition in a female cannabis plantthe resulting seeds are nearly identical to the self-pollinated female parent, as just one set of genes is present.
This is attained through numerous techniques: By spraying the plant with a service of colloidal silver, a liquid containing small particles of silver, Through a method called rodelization, in which a female plant pressed previous maturity can pollinate another female,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ormonal agent that activates germination (this is much less typical) The majority of knowledgeable or business growers will not use feminized seeds because they just contain one set of genes, and these ought to never be used for breeding purposes - best feminized seeds. However, a lot of beginning growers start with feminized seeds since they remove the concern of having to deal with male plants.

They are easy to grow since you do not have to fret about light cycles and just how much light a plant receives. A lot of cannabis plants begin blooming when the quantity of light they receive daily minimizes. Outdoors, this occurs when the sun starts setting earlier in the day as the season turns from summer season to autumn. Indoor growers can control when a plant flowers by lowering the day-to-day quantity of light plants get from 18 hours to 12 hours - best feminized seeds.
Autoflowers can be begun in early spring and will flower during the longest days of summer, benefiting from high quality light to grow y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can begin aut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all (cheap autoflowering seeds). Also,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any little grow, or growing outdoors where you don't desire your ne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ple big disadvantages, though: Autoflower stress are known for being less powerful. Also, since they are small in stature, they normally do not produce big yields.

C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own jointly as cannabinoidsfound in the cannabis plant. Over the years, human beings have actually selected plants for high-THC content, making marijuana with high levels of CBD rare. The hereditary paths through which THC is manufactured by the plant are different than those for CBD production. Cannabis used for hemp production has actually been picked for other characteristics, including a low THC material, so regarding adhere to the 2018 Farm Expense.
As interest in CBD as a medicine has actually grown, numerous breeders have actually cr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These stress have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C material together with substantial amounts of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these varieties are now commonly available online and through dispensaries. It needs to be kept in mind, however, that any plant grown from these seeds is not guaranteed to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es lots of years to produce a seed line that produces consistent outcomes - what are feminized seeds. A grower aiming to produce cannabis with a certain THC to CBD ratio will need to grow from a tested and proven clone or seed.

Marijuana seeds require three things to germinate: water, heat, and air. There are many methods to germinate seeds, but for the most typical and easiest technique, you will require: Two clean plates, Four pa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els must be soaked but shouldn't have excess water running off.
Then, position the marijuana seeds at least an inch apart from each other and cover them with the staying two water-soaked paper towels. To develop a dark, protected area,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Ensure the location the seeds are in is warm, somewhere in between 70-85F. After completing these actions, it's time to wait. Check the paper towels when a day to ensure they're still saturated, and if they are losing wetness, use more water to keep the seeds happy - pot seeds feminized. Some seeds sprout extremely quickly while others can take a while, but normally, seeds need to germinate in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ually germinated as soon as the seed splits and a single sprout appears. The sprout is the taproot, which will end up being the main stem of the plant, and seeing it is a sign of effective germination. It's essential to keep the fragile seed sterilized, so don't touch the seed or taproot as it starts to divide. As soon as you see the taproot, it's time to move your sprouted seed into its growing medium, such as soil. autoflowering seeds. Fill a 4-inch or one-gallon pot with loose, airy potting soil, Water the soil prior to you put the seed in; it must be damp however not drenched, Poke a hole in the soil with a pen or pencilthe rule of thumb is: make the hole two times as deep as the seed is large, Using a pair of tweezers, gently put the seed in the hole with the taproot dealing with down, Gently cover it with soil Keep a close eye on the temperature level and wetness level of the soil to keep the seed delighted.

Utilize a spray bottle to water itover-watering can suffocate and kill the delicate grow. Within a week or two you need to see a seedling begin to grow from the soil. Germinating marijuana seeds does not always go as prepared. Some seeds will be duds. Others will be slow and take longer to grow. But some will pop rapidly and grow quickly. This is the appeal of seedsoften, you can tell which plants or genes will grow right from the start. This will assist you determine which plants you wish to take cuttings from for clones or for breeding if you wish to produce a seed bank of your own.
